Analysis of the chemical constituents of Hedan tablet by HPLC-TOF-MS method
Pharmaceutical Care and Research(2011)
摘要
Objective: To analyze the chemical constituents of Hedan tablet by high performance liquid chromatography-time of flight-mass spectrometry (HPLC-TOF-MS). Methods: The separation was performed on a Agilent Zorbax SB-Aq column (250 mmx4.6 mm, 5 μm). The mobile phase consisting of acetonitrile (A)-1% acetic acid water solution (B) was used as gradient elute, 0-50 min, 0%-30% B, 50-90 min, 30%-75% B. The flow rate was 1 ml/min. TOF-MS was applied for qualitative analysis in positive ion mode with m/z of reference fragment 121.05 and 922.01. Results: The 33 chemical constituents of Hedan tablet were identified, and 5 groups of isomers were discriminated by TOF-MS and structure-relevant fragment ions. Conclusion: The HPLC-TOF-MS method is simple and reliable for analysis of the chemical constituents of Hedan tablets.
